Water damage can result in critical penalties, particularly in relation to the growth of mold. Understanding the way to prevent mold growth after water damage is crucial for sustaining a wholesome indoor setting. Mold thrives in damp conditions, and any constructing materials that continues to be wet for more than 24 hours can turn into a breeding floor for mold spores.


The first step in preventing mold development includes the quick addressing of the water damage itself. Swift action is important to reduce moisture ranges. This can embrace stopping the supply of the water intrusion, whether it’s a burst pipe, leaking roof, or flooding. Once the supply is mounted, the next move is to drain any standing water.


After eradicating any standing water, drying out your house completely is the following priority. Dehumidifiers serve as a robust ally on this process, successfully extracting moisture from the air and surfaces. When used alongside followers to circulate air, dehumidifiers can significantly reduce humidity levels and pace up the drying process. Aim for an indoor humidity stage of round 30-50% to create an environment much less conducive to mold progress.


It’s crucial to examine all affected areas. Walls, floors, furniture, and even your belongings can harbor moisture, making them potential mold hotspots. Pay special attention to hidden areas corresponding to behind drywall, under carpets, or inside insulation. These areas might require skilled help to ensure they're utterly dried out.

Cleaning materials uncovered to water is one other vital step to stopping mold. Water Damage Restoration. While some gadgets could additionally be salvageable, porous materials like carpets and upholstery might need to be discarded in the event that they cannot be sufficiently dried and cleaned. Non-porous surfaces, on the other hand, ought to be scrubbed with a mixture of detergent and water. Using an appropriate mold-inhibiting cleaner can also provide further safety.


Ventilation plays a big position in controlling moisture ranges. Open home windows if the weather permits, or use exhaust fans in loos and kitchens to attenuate humidity. Continuous airflow will help dry out affected areas, and this is particularly critical after water damage happens.


For larger areas impacted by important water intrusion, skilled cleansing and restoration services can save time and guarantee thorough remediation. Experts have specialized instruments and techniques to detect moisture that's not easily visible and to dry out affected buildings efficiently. Consulting professionals may also present peace of thoughts, knowing that mold risks have been adequately addressed.


Keep in mind that mold spores are ever-present within the surroundings. They don't want a big amount of moisture to survive. Since mold can begin to develop within just 24 to forty eight hours after water publicity, it's essential to act promptly and effectively. Regular inspections after a water incident can help catch any mold development earlier than it escalates.

Another preventative step entails using mold-resistant products and supplies in any repairs. Mold-resistant drywall, paint, and insulation can significantly diminish the likelihood of mold taking maintain in the future. Implementing these supplies through the restoration process can save intensive bother down the road - Fire And Water Damage Restoration Companies Near Me Tuscaloosa AL.


Also, be sure that your house maintains efficient drainage and proper grading across the foundation. This helps divert water away from your property. Keeping gutters clean and in good condition can prevent water from backing up and creating future moisture issues.

Routine maintenance is vital to mold prevention. Periodically check basements, attics, and crawl areas for signs of water intrusion and tackle any leaks immediately. Household crops also can contribute to humidity levels; maintaining indoor plant watering to a minimum can further help control moisture ranges within the residence.


If you might have experienced a flood, be mindful that the type of water is a crucial factor as well. Clean water from a broken pipe could pose less risk for mold progress than gray water from washing machines or black water from sewage backups. Each type requires specific cleansing protocols that may impact both prevention and restoration methods.

  • Act shortly to remove standing water within 24 to forty eight hours to attenuate moisture ranges.

  • Use followers and dehumidifiers to enhance air circulation and extract excess humidity from affected areas.

  • Thoroughly dry all supplies, including carpets, insulation, and wooden, as mold thrives in damp substrates.

  • Clean and disinfect all surfaces with mold-inhibiting options to forestall spore development.

  • Inspect and repair any leaks in plumbing or roofing to forestall future moisture intrusion.

  • Remove and properly get rid of any contaminated supplies that cannot be adequately cleaned.

  • Maintain optimal indoor humidity ranges (between 30-50%) using a hygrometer for monitoring.

  • Ensure correct ventilation in areas vulnerable to moisture, similar to bogs and kitchens.

  • Regularly check and clear gutters and downspouts to keep away from water pooling across the basis of the home.

  • Educate family members concerning the importance of mold prevention practices and early signs of moisture issues.
